Introduction

Currycombs are essential tools for horse owners and groomers, designed specifically to keep your horse's coat clean and healthy. When it comes to grooming, a currycomb is a must-have because it effectively loosens dirt and hair, making it easier to remove with a brush. By regularly using a currycomb, you can maintain your horse's coat in top condition, promoting a shiny and healthy appearance.

Here are some key benefits of using a currycomb:
  • Efficient Cleaning: The unique design of the currycomb allows it to reach deep into the coat, removing dirt and debris that can cause skin irritation.
  • Improved Circulation: The massaging action of the currycomb stimulates blood flow to the skin, which can enhance coat health.
  • Versatile Use: Suitable for various coat types, currycombs can be used on horses, dogs, and other animals, making them a versatile addition to your grooming kit.
  • Durable Materials: Most currycombs are made from sturdy materials that withstand regular use, ensuring they last for years.
  • Easy to Use: With a simple back-and-forth motion, anyone can effectively use a currycomb, making grooming less of a chore.

By incorporating a currycomb into your grooming routine, you ensure that your horse remains comfortable and clean. Remember, a well-groomed horse is not only healthier but also happier. For best results, combine the currycomb with brushes and other grooming tools for a complete grooming experience.

FAQs

How often should I use a currycomb on my horse?

It's recommended to use a currycomb at least once a week, or more frequently if your horse is active or in muddy conditions.

Can I use a currycomb on my dog?

Yes, currycombs can be used on dogs, especially those with short coats, to remove loose hair and dirt.

What are the different types of currycombs available?

Currycombs come in various materials such as rubber, metal, and plastic, with different designs tailored for specific coat types.

Are there any common mistakes when using a currycomb?

One common mistake is using too much force; it's important to use gentle pressure to avoid irritating the skin.

How do I clean my currycomb?

To clean your currycomb, simply rinse it under water to remove hair and dirt, and let it air dry before storing.
